Hot yoga, also known as Bikram yoga, is a type of yoga practiced in a heated room, typically set to a temperature of 105 degrees Fahrenheit (40.6 degrees Celsius) with 40% humidity. Hot yoga is said to have many benefits, including increased flexibility, strength, and endurance, as well as reduced stress and anxiety.

Hot yoga is a challenging practice, but it can be a great way to improve your overall health and well-being. If you’re considering trying hot yoga, be sure to talk to your doctor first to make sure it’s right for you.

One of the most well-known benefits of hot yoga is its ability to improve flexibility. The heat helps to relax the muscles, which makes it easier to stretch and move into different poses. This can be especially beneficial for people who are new to yoga, or who have tight muscles. Improved flexibility can also help to reduce the risk of injury, and it can make everyday activities easier and more comfortable.

Hot yoga can also help to improve strength and endurance. The heat helps to increase blood flow to the muscles, which can help to improve muscle strength and power. Additionally, the challenging poses in hot yoga can help to build endurance and stamina. Improved strength and endurance can benefit people in all aspects of their lives, from sports and fitness to everyday activities.

Finally, hot yoga can also help to reduce stress and anxiety. The heat helps to relax the body and mind, and the focus on breath and movement can help to clear the mind and reduce stress levels. Hot yoga can also be a great way to escape from the stresses of everyday life and to find some peace and relaxation.

Hot yoga is a challenging practice, but it can be modified to suit all levels. This is one of the things that makes it so popular, as it is accessible to people of all ages and fitness levels. There are a number of ways to modify hot yoga poses to make them easier or more challenging, depending on your individual needs.

READ:  Unlock Your Inner Warrior: Yoga For Men Beginners

  • Use props: Props such as blocks, straps, and blankets can be used to help you get into and hold poses. For example, if you are new to hot yoga or have tight hamstrings, you can use a block to support your foot in forward folds.
  • Modify the poses: There are many different ways to modify hot yoga poses. For example, you can bend your knees in standing poses, or you can take breaks in child’s pose. If you are feeling dizzy or lightheaded, you can come out of the pose and rest.
  • Listen to your body: It is important to listen to your body and take breaks when needed. If you are feeling pain, stop the pose and rest. You should never push yourself too hard, especially in hot yoga.

Hot yoga is a challenging practice, and it’s important to be aware of the risks involved. One of the most important things to keep in mind is that hot yoga can be dangerous for people with certain health conditions, such as heart disease, high blood pressure, and asthma. It’s also important to stay hydrated and to listen to your body. If you start to feel dizzy, lightheaded, or nauseous, stop practicing and rest.

Hot yoga studios should take steps to ensure the safety of their students. This includes providing clear instructions on how to practice safely, having qualified instructors on staff, and maintaining a clean and well-ventilated environment. Students should also be aware of the risks of hot yoga and take precautions to stay safe.

By following these guidelines, you can help to ensure that your hot yoga practice is safe and enjoyable.

Hot Yoga Tips

Hot yoga is a challenging but rewarding practice that offers numerous benefits for your physical and mental well-being. Here are some tips to help you get the most out of your hot yoga practice:

Tip 1: Stay hydrated. Drink plenty of water before, during, and after your hot yoga class. This will help to prevent dehydration and keep your body functioning properly.

Tip 2: Listen to your body. If you start to feel dizzy, lightheaded, or nauseous, stop practicing and rest. It’s important to listen to your body and take breaks when needed.

Tip 3: Wear loose, comfortable clothing. You’ll sweat a lot during hot yoga, so it’s important to wear loose, comfortable clothing that will allow you to move freely.

Tip 4: Bring a towel. You’ll need a towel to wipe away sweat during your hot yoga class. It’s also a good idea to bring a towel to place under your mat to prevent slipping.

Tip 5: Don’t eat a heavy meal before class. Eating a heavy meal before hot yoga can make you feel uncomfortable and sluggish. It’s best to eat a light meal or snack before class.

Tip 6: Arrive early. Arrive early for your hot yoga class so you have time to warm up and get settled in. This will help you to get the most out of your practice.

Tip 7: Be patient. Hot yoga can be challenging, but it’s important to be patient and keep practicing. The more you practice, the better you will become.

Tip 8: Have fun! Hot yoga is a great way to improve your physical and mental health, but it’s also important to have fun. Enjoy the practice and the benefits it brings.
